Easements grant the right to make use of another's residential property for a certain objective, such as access or utility lines. They can be created via various methods, such as express agreement, ramification, need, or prescription, and can be ended with abandonment, merger, end of requirement, demolition, taping act, stricture, damaging ownership, or release. Easements might have an influence on the worth of a building and might restrict specific tasks on the home. To confirm the boundary of acquiescence, both celebrations have to concur that a certain line exists and must acknowledge that line as a lawful border in between residential properties. Courts might make use of proof of historical and continued usage by landowners to determine if they meet the demands.
